    Welcome to Xbox Community Forums. We appreciate for sharing your concern with us and we hope that you are doing well today.

    We understand the inconvenience caused. We will be glad to assist you with this. However, before we proceed, we would like to ask some questions about it.

    1. Have you check if there are programs blocking outgoing connections?
    2. Do you have existing firewall program? Try to disable it or change its configuration.
    3. Did you try to restart your modem or router?
    • You may also want to try logging out of your account and then logging back in, as this refreshes your profile's authentication and connection with our servers.
    Here are some suggested steps for you to try.

    Resetting the app?
    1. Open the Start Menu and click the Settings icon
    2. Click "Apps" and go to the "Apps & Features" tab
    3. Find Minecraft and click it, then "Advanced Options"
    4. Click "Reset"

    Sometimes using proxy to connect to the internet may cause issues while connecting to the network. Follow the steps below to disable proxy:

    *Open the New Modern Settings
    *Select Network & Internet
    *Go to Proxy
    *Disable Use Proxy Server

    Now Open Windows Store it should work if it doesn't try to also Disable Automatically Detect Settings & Use Script Setup. Alternately Try Enabling them, & some enable disabled combination with these 3 options.
